Transaction e56acc253af84a9bcdde14db82ea9092aa1ff566e446a1710ce63834f6ff80b3
1 Input
1 Output
-
e56acc253af84a9bcdde14db82ea9092aa1ff566e446a1710ce63834f6ff80b3:0
- value
- 13984425
- script pubkey
- OP_0 OP_PUSHBYTES_20 dbdbfac677f7b02a04a32ef9e1932701976b8cdd
- address
- bc1qm0dl43nh77cz5p9r9mu7rye8qxtkhrxanhga3p